Adelaide LETS

The Local Exchange Trading System (LETS) is a non-profit community organisation which enables its members to exchange goods and services with each other without using traditional currency.

Earn units doing things you enjoy, spend your units on things or services you need. One unit is equivalent to one dollar. We have a monthly market at Payneham, and have pop up markets at other locations throughout the year.

One Planet Market

Regular Market and Trading Day, held on every 3rd Saturday of the month.

374 Payneham Road, Payneham – 9am to 12pm (*10am to 1pm in Winter months) – held outdoors (weather permitting, otherwise held inside the community centre)

In addition to LETS market stalls, the One Planet Market also has a produce swap stall for fruit, veggies, seeds, and seedlings, along with a Freecycle swap table for good quality second hand goods.

The Repair Cafe is also open, and skilled volunteers will also be there from 9:30am, to help with electrical, electronic, mechanical and sewing repair jobs as well as tinkering of toys, glueing of household items, sharpening tasks and locksmith problems.
